Virtual BWRT Therapy: Accessible Support for Emotional Wounds

BWRT, or Brain-Working Recursive Therapy, provides a powerful approach to healing emotional wounds. Traditionally delivered in person, BWRT is now increasingly available online, removing geographical barriers and delivering support to a wider variety of individuals. This method allows people to access therapy from the safety of their own homes, at a time that is convenient for them. Online BWRT meetings can be particularly helpful for individuals who face challenges with getting to appointments. It also extends greater freedom for those with busy schedules or limited mobility.
